Here, only the smokes which are used for fireworks are discussed.<br \/>\nThe processes classified as follows:<br \/>\n1.\tThe burning grows to form a mist which absorbs the moisture from the atmosphere. Smoke composition, for example. The hexachloroethane smoke composition creates a vapor of zinc chloride or aluminum chloride, which becomes white smoke when it combines with moisture in the air. At present carbon tetrachloride smoke composition is seldom used.<br \/>\n2.\tThe material is first vaporized by the heat of combustion and then condenses again to fine solid particles which creste smoke. The white smoke caused by sulphur and yellow smoke caused by realgar belong to this type.<br \/>\n3.\tSmoke cause by incomplete of a composition. This type of smoke is widely used as black smoke in fireworks. It utilizes the carbon particles created by the incomplete combustion of naphthalene or anthracene.<br \/>\n4.\tColored smoke produced by vaporizing dye. A volatile dye is first vaporized and then it condense the fine solid particles, which look like colored smoke. Generall this kind smoke shows its own beautiful color by reflected light, but it looks dirty when the light is weak. In a cloudy sky it does not have a good color. Generally the color of the aqueous solution of dye from permeated light is the same as the color of cloudy solid particles in reflected light. Physically it is an interesting problem.<\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Pyrotechnic smoke for practical use can easily be obtained from a simple smoke device without any special technique, and must be safe to handle.
